— Meet Audrey Rey Espinosa
“Audrey discovered yoga in 2010 as a powerful tool for managing anxiety and healing from wrist tendinitis and lower back pain. Her journey deepened in 2013 when she completed her first 200-hour teacher training, later advancing her practice with a 300-hour SmartFlow certification under Annie Carpenter. She has also trained with Yoga Medicine, Ma Yoga, Ana Forrest, and Maty Ezraty, continually expanding her knowledge and approach to teaching.
Her passion for prenatal yoga grew through her own journey into motherhood. After completing her 85-hour Prenatal Yoga Teacher Training in 2016 with April Lovett of Unfold Yoga, she dedicated herself to supporting mothers through yoga—leading prenatal lectures for teacher trainings, hosting mom support groups, and teaching kids yoga, baby & me, and family yoga classes.
During the pandemic, Audrey helped cultivate a local yoga community by hosting outdoor yoga in the park. This journey led her to co-own Yoga Sanctum in her hometown of Whittier, alongside Jovon of Late Downey Yoga, building a space dedicated to connection, healing, and growth.
Audrey is a co-teacher in Yoga Sanctum’s Teacher Training Program and the creator of Seasonal Soul Circle, a signature offering that blends yoga, meditation, and sound healing. With a deep love for yoga philosophy, she empowers students with teachings that inspire self-awareness and transformation.
